Miss World Coronation Ball Case Study

About Project

The Event Production Company was tasked with staging a glittering Miss World Coronation Ball and black-tie banquet for 1200 high level guests, as the culmination of the Miss World Pageant at the Sandton Convention Centre in Johannesburg. In addition, we organised the Mayoral Welcome Banquet for 500 guests for the Miss World Contestants and their entourage upon their arrival in South Africa.

The challenge:

Working in conjunction with the Johannesburg Tourism Company (JTC) we had a tight two-week deadline to pull together the Coronation Banquet and Ball – an international highlight and celebration on the Miss World Calendar.

The Event Production Company managed the event in its entirety - from the design and production of the event and overseeing all the hospitality, logistics, staging, audio-visual aspects and live entertainment down to the personalized, printed and electronic invitations.

Managing the invitations and guest list for such a sought-after event proved tricky, with many – from the media and the public - clamouring for admission. In addition to handling invitations, responses and seating arrangements for the 1200 guests, The Event Production Company team had to ensure that guests were also zoned and seated according to the speciality hospitality packages they had booked.

The result:

The Event Production Company rose to challenges and time constraints, producing a fabulous, fun-filled, memorable banquet and ball in record time for the Miss World team and sponsors – and of course, not forgetting the world’s most glamorous girls and their families.
